The condition of a property plays an important role in determining its value, with the degree of impact varying by property type, size and location.
For 82, The Crescent, Bristol, we estimate a market value of £773,286 and a rental value of £2,553 per month when presented in very good decorative order. Should the property require extensive cosmetic improvement, those figures would reduce to £684,911 and £2,261 per month respectively.
